We present the new function of tunable hollow waveguides with a variable air core. We show a possibility of wide-angle beam steering from the hollow waveguide and efficient tilt-coupling in narrow air core hollow waveguides. Wide-angle beam steering was demonstrated by calculation and preliminary experiment. In addition, a possibility of an efficient optical coupling with a narrow air core was presented by the tilt-coupling scheme. Input and output coupling losses are 2.5 dB and 1 dB for 1 mu m air core, respectively. Wide tunability in sub-wavelength air cores enables us to realize new functions of tunable hollow waveguides and circuits. |
